Fix task edit crashing after due_date/due_time save (regression from reminders)

The web edit/create/quick-add views and the sync endpoint assigned
due_date/due_time/reminder_at straight from request data as raw strings.
Django tolerates this at save() (types get coerced deep in the SQL
layer), but the in-memory instance keeps the raw strings afterward.
Task.reschedule_reminders(), added for per-task reminders and run from
save() on that same instance, was the first code to actually operate on
those fields before a page reload and crashed with a TypeError - which
the service worker's 5xx-treated-as-offline fallback then masked as a
misleading "you're offline" screen instead of a real error.

Fixed by parsing with Django's parse_date/parse_time/parse_datetime at
the point these values are read from the request/payload in
tasks/views.py and sync/views.py, rather than trusting raw strings.

5 new regression tests exercise the actual views/endpoint with raw
date/time strings and assert proper types land on the model.
